I like the Thai silk produce also. I did the El D in silk and it was the first one I did in over 20yrs. One thing I learned with today's dope is use the right clear. I tried to use Lite Coat (I have a gallon of this in the shop) and didn't remember it is low shrink, not good for the getting the silk tight. After a post on this forum I switched to Sig Super Coat Clear. Now it will loosen for the first several coats. On the El D even with the couple coats of Lite Coat it took about six coats and boom it got drum tight. I mention this because from coat 2 to 5 I was ready to tear it off, everyone said keep going and it worked. I never had covering sag once the dope dried, new dope seems to take a few coats.
